Carnatic musician Shri Uppalapu Srinivas, sometimes called the Mandolin Srinivas for his expertise at playing the instrument, passed away in a private hospital in Chennai this morning. Media reports suggested that the musician had undergone liver transplant recently  but developed complications which led to his death. He was 45 year old at the time of his death.

Srinivas had started playing the instrument when he was five year old and played on stage for the first time when he was nine. He was the first musician to use the instrument in Carnatic music.

He was awarded the Padma Shri in 1998 and the Sangeet Natak Akademi Award in 2010.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i today condoled the death of carnatic musician U Srinivas and recalled the mandolin maestro's long-standing contribution to music.

"The Prime Minister expressed grief on the passing away of renowned musician Shri Uppalapu Shrinivas," his official Twitter handle, @PMOIndia said.
"The PM recalled the Mandolin Maestro's dedication & long-standing contribution towards music & added that he will always be remembered," another tweet said.

Musician Ehsaan Noorani, Sonu Nigam and others took to Twitter to condole his death.
